Enterprise teams are discovering that AI coding assistants—positioned as productivity multipliers—actually consume budget at rates that make traditional software spending look quaint. Uber exhausted a full year's allocation in four months. Microsoft yanked Claude access mid-contract. The industry's sudden appetite for a standards body isn't idealism; it's a bid to create negotiating leverage and predictability against vendors (OpenAI, Anthropic, GitHub) who've built pricing models that reward consumption rather than outcomes. What was supposed to be a tool has become a cost center with no clear ROI ceiling.
